Augury

By Emily Summerhays

I peered into a puddle
and saw the sky,
as if I had lain
on the pavement and looked up
through the spreading fingers
of the trees.

Gazing
into the sheen
of the sidewalk,
I watched the heavens
and saw them tremble
at my passing.
